From 4d2918276be05e880f633f2ff70dca3f08791ab9 Mon Sep 17 00:00:00 2001 From: OBattler Date: Mon, 8 Oct 2018 01:22:37 +0200 Subject: [PATCH] The OAK OTI-077 now correctly reports 256k memory when 256k is set. --- src/video/vid_oak_oti.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/video/vid_oak_oti.c b/src/video/vid_oak_oti.c index f6e70a0de..925b94304 100644 --- a/src/video/vid_oak_oti.c +++ b/src/video/vid_oak_oti.c @@ -8,7 +8,7 @@ * * Oak OTI037C/67/077 emulation. * - * Version: @(#)vid_oak_oti.c 1.0.15 2018/10/07 + * Version: @(#)vid_oak_oti.c 1.0.16 2018/10/07 * * Authors: Sarah Walker, * Miran Grca, @@ -149,7 +149,7 @@ oti_out(uint16_t addr, uint8_t val, void *p) if (val & 0xc) svga->vram_display_mask = MIN(oti->vram_mask, 0x7ffff); break; - case 0x20: /* 512 kB of memory */ + case 0x02: /* 512 kB of memory */ enable = (oti->vram_size >= 512); if (val & 0xc) svga->vram_display_mask = MIN(oti->vram_mask, 0xfffff);